I'm getting nervous about this luteal phase thing... Anyone know how common it is for it to be too short while breastfeeding? I don't know how long mine is yet...

https://kellymom.com/bf/normal/fertility/ Has some good info.

It's all very variable and differs form woman to woman. My understanding is that for most women the transition from not fertile to fertile is gradual and you will likely have cycles where you can't conceive and LP is short before being fully fertile.

The Kellymom article states
A very small percentage of women will become pregnant during their first postpartum ovulation, without having had a postpartum period. Per fertility researcher Alan S. McNeilly, this “is rare and in our experience is related to a rapid reduction in suckling input.”
This was true for me. I had no AF between babies, but I returned to work and night weaned DD within a space of 2 weeks representing a sudden reduction in nursing. This time I'm not at work so DS is still nursing a lot during the day and AF has returned with a suspected short LP.

Your LP should get longer as baby takes more solids and nurses less often.
